INSPECTION PROCEDURE O-17: Transmitter: The lock, unlock, trunk or panic switch signal is not sent to the ETACS-ECU.: Diagnosis
Required Special Tools:
- MB991223: Test Harness Set
- MB991502: Scan Tool (MUT-II)
- MB991529: Diagnostic Trouble Code Check Harness
- STEP 1. Register the transmitter.
Register the transmitter (Refer to Keyless Entry System - On-vehicle Service - ENCRYPTED CODE REGISTRATION METHOD .)
Q: Is the transmitter registered successfully?
YES : The transmitter input signal should be able to be checked and the functions, which are described in the "TECHNICAL DESCRIPTION (COMMENT) ," should work normally.
NO: Go to Step 2.
- STEP 2. Check the transmitter battery.
Measure the transmitter battery's voltage.
- The value should be approximately 2.5 - 3.2 volts.
Q: Is the measured voltage approximately 12 volts (battery positive voltage)?
YES : Go to Step 3.
NO: Replace the battery. If the transmitter is registered successfully, the transmitter input signal should be able to be checked and the functions, which are described in the "TECHNICAL DESCRIPTION (COMMENT) ," should work normally.
- STEP 3. Check the transmitter.
Use an other transmitter to register the secret code. (Refer to Keyless Entry System - On-vehicle Service - ENCRYPTED CODE REGISTRATION METHOD .)
Q: Is the transmitter registered successfully?
YES : The transmitter input signal should be able to be checked and the functions, which are described in the "TECHNICAL DESCRIPTION (COMMENT) ," should work normally.
NO: Replace the ETACS-ECU. The transmitter input signal should be able to be checked and the functions, which are described in the "TECHNICAL DESCRIPTION (COMMENT) ," should work normally.
